Seasonal Produce Farms
Rotating farms · Bay Area and Central Coast
North Beach carries a rotating selection of 8–12 produce farms during its May–November season. The market was established in 2018 and expanded its footprint significantly in 2021. Because the season runs through the peak of California's agricultural calendar — from spring strawberries through summer stone fruit and into fall squash and citrus — the produce selection is consistently strong despite the market's smaller size. Vendor rosters vary week to week.

ABOUT THIS MARKET

The North Beach Farmers Market opened in 2018 — one of SF's newest markets. It runs every Saturday from May through November on Columbus Avenue near the Joe DiMaggio Playground and Coit Tower, in the heart of one of SF's most historically dense neighborhoods. It is volunteer-organized, which gives it an independently community character uncommon among SF's market landscape. The market expanded to a new, larger location in 2021, nearly doubling its footprint.

Unlike year-round markets, North Beach's seasonal nature means it operates during the most abundant months of California's growing calendar — the period when tomatoes are at peak, stone fruit is in season, and the weather makes outdoor shopping appealing. Closed in winter.
